The Job Club brings together unemployed people of all ages and backgrounds who have a real interest in finding work. Services offered include Job Seeking Skills, CV Preparation, Job Applications, Interview Preparation, Confidence Building and Mock Interviews. The Job Club programme duration is 3 weeks, Monday – Friday from 9.30 – 12.30. Support, advice and information for those considering self employment. This service will guide you through the steps to running your own business. Service includes free, confidential 1-1 meetings where you can discuss any aspect of your (future) business, business plan development, assistance in applying for funding, Back To Work Enterprise Allowance scheme and much more.

The National Training and Employment Authority, FÁS anticipates the needs of, and responds to, a constantly changing labour market. FÁS operates training and employment programmes; provides a recruitment service to jobseekers and employers, an advisory service for industry, and supports community-based enterprises. To register for this service you must be:
- Seeking Employment / Training / Education
- Aged 17 years and no longer in the school system
- Be living in the Dublin 15 area
- Have permission to work in Ireland

The Money Advice and Budgeting Service (MABS) is a free, confidential, independent, non-judgemental and non-profit making service for people in debt or at risk of getting into debt.
